The Rise of Mobile Commerce

In the ever-evolving world of e-commerce, mobile devices are taking center stage as the preferred platform for online shopping. With consumers increasingly reliant on their smartphones, prioritizing mobile-first design and delivering seamless user experiences have become essential for businesses aiming to engage their audience effectively. Simultaneously, the focus on secure mobile payment solutions is advancing to instill greater user confidence, ensuring that sleek, intuitive design is complemented by uncompromising security.

Artificial Intelligence and E-commerce

Artificial Intelligence is transforming the e-commerce landscape by redefining the shopping experience through AI-driven personalization. By delivering recommendations tailored to individual preferences and behaviors, it creates a more engaging and satisfying customer journey.

Chatbots, powered by advanced machine learning algorithms, are revolutionizing customer support by providing cost-effective, round-the-clock assistance, efficiently managing inquiries and support tickets. Meanwhile, behind the scenes, AI is streamlining logistics and supply chain management—key components that underpin the speed and reliability essential to successful e-commerce operations.

Virtual and Augmented Reality in E-commerce

Virtual Reality (VR) and Augmented Reality (AR) are revolutionizing the traditional shopping experience, allowing consumers to visualize products in their own environment through virtual try-ons and interactive showcases.

These immersive technologies are bridging the sensory gap that has long been a challenge for online shopping, offering a more engaging and realistic experience. As 2025 approaches, the strategic adoption of VR and AR has the potential to become a powerful driver of conversions in the e-commerce space.

The Growth of Social Commerce

E-commerce is increasingly thriving on social media platforms, as brands harness the ubiquity of these channels to connect with shoppers where they spend much of their time. The combination of influencer marketing and social commerce has demonstrated its ability to amplify brand visibility and drive sales. By embedding e-commerce functionalities directly into these platforms, the consumer journey—from product discovery to purchase—becomes seamless, propelling the rapid growth of social commerce.

The Future of E-commerce Logistics

The rise of same-day delivery is redefining expectations for delivery speed, pushing logisticians to innovate through the use of automation and robotics in warehousing to meet demand. Additionally, the potential of drone delivery is being actively explored as a means to accelerate shipping, offering the possibility of transforming last-mile delivery and elevating customer satisfaction to new heights.

The Impact of 5G on E-commerce

5G technology is set to revolutionize e-commerce operations with its lightning-fast connectivity and enhanced user experiences. By significantly reducing loading times and boosting performance, it will also strengthen the integration of IoT (Internet of Things) in e-commerce, providing richer data to deliver personalized shopping experiences and streamline operations with greater efficiency.
